JAKARTA - All sectors are affected by the COVID-19 outbreak. Not only in the transportation, tourism and business sectors, but also the pharmaceutical or health sectors were also affected.

Deputy Chairperson of the Indonesian Chamber of Commerce and Industry (Kadin), Suryani Motik, said that based on the reports received by her party, due to Pageblu, the pharmaceutical sector had at least laid off 200 thousand workers.

"Some can pay their salaries, but they can only last until June or July. Most have started laying off their employees. The pharmaceutical sector has 200,000 layoffs," he said, in a video conference with journalists, Thursday, June 18.

Not only that, Suryani said, the pharmaceutical industry, both retail and drug suppliers, was also experiencing financial problems. This condition is exacerbated by the unpaid debt of BPJS Health that has reached IDR 3 trillion.

"BPJS (Health) has a debt to the Pharmacy Association of Rp. 3 trillion. The hospital industry is also problematic. So retail pharmacy and supplies to the hospital will pay for it later, because usually the hospital pays doctors, nurses and medicines first," he explained.

Suryani admitted that the problems in the health industry have actually occurred for a long time. Meanwhile, the business life of the hospital is also problematic because many Indonesians prefer to seek treatment abroad rather than undergo treatment at home.
